ConfHandler/BBHandler: Improve comment error messages and add tests
Currently if you trigger one of the comment errors, the newline characters
are stripped and the line numbers are incorrect. In one case it prints
the empty line which is also unhelpful.
Rework the code around these errors so the line numbers are correct
and the lines in question are more clearly displayed complete with newlines
so the user can more clearly see the error.
I also added a couple of simplistic test cases to ensure that errors
are raised by the two known comment format errors.
[YOCTO #11904]
